This substantial detached cottage resides in this large private plot in the rural village of Saltfleetby. Offered for sale with no forward chain, the property is in need of a complete programme of renovation works throughout, in order for it to realise its full potential. There is an additional detached garage / workshop in the grounds, as well as large area for parking multiple vehicles and could accommodate a large motor home. There is a huge rear ground floor extension which is unfinished and in need of cosmetic updating, internal viewings are essential in order to fully appreciate the sheer space on offer within this large family home which is priced for early sale and with the need for renovation in mind.
